16 Issue 3 2020 HIRE AWARDS OF EXCELLENCE 2020 W inners of the Hire Awards of Excellence were announced at a virtual awards ceremony, live streamed to more than 50 companies from within the hire industry for plant, tool, equipment and events sectors on September 16th. Outgoing HAE EHA CEO Graham Arundell received the Outstanding Contribution to Hire award. As he made the announcement, Association Chairman Brian Sherlock said: “Since January 2007, Graham Arundell, as CEO of the association, has increased member numbers, restructured the organisation to meet the challenges faced - whether that was the financial crash of 2008, driving more commerciality within the association or giving us a voice within Government and the market. I would like to thank him on behalf of the board and members of HAE EHA for his dedication and drive which has seen the organisation change fundamentally since he has been in position.” Successful companies on the day included Sunbelt Rentals, which collected the awards for Website of the Year and SafeHire Event Hire Company of the Year; AFI Uplift whose staff members received individual accolades for both Young Apprentice of the Year and Workshop Manager of the Year; and Cardiff- based independent Miles Hire which was awarded the SafeHire Plant, Tool & Equipment Hire Company of the Year Turnover Up To £10 million. Travis Perkins was also a multi- winner on the day, receiving the awards for Best Use of New Media and SafeHire Plant, Tool & Equipment Hire Company of the Year Turnover Over £10 million. Tool Hire Managing Director at Travis Perkins, Catherine Gibson, said: “It’s a huge honour to have received two acclaimed awards in such highly contested HAE categories. It is truly great to be recognised as the benchmark and gold standard. Our safety initiative, based on the key insight and root cause of safety incidents, was implemented by a knowledgeable team who worked tirelessly to ensure Travis Perkins set the right example. “The same desire to push boundaries also applies to how we utilise new media channels, being able to showcase the breadth of equipment available via a highly engaging digital video. We are delighted to be receiving these two accolades and well done to the Travis Perkins teams across tool hire operations, marketing, safety and group technology services.” On the individual award front, Rob Thompson, General Manager of GoHire, received this year’s Hire Manager of the Year and Hire Achiever of the Year awards, and was clearly thrilled to have his accomplishments acknowledged, saying: “Winning both Hire Manager of the Year and the overall Hire Achiever of the Year awards is a huge honour. I was watching the live stream with family and work colleagues, when both awards were announced everybody was ecstatic. I have already received numerous congratulations from clients and staff.” Winners Announced at virtual awards ceremony.
